原因分析:

是操作数据库的用户被锁定了,思路是通过查找目标用户,将其解锁即可,可是这样太麻烦了。

解决办法执行如下sql:

USE master;  
GO  
DECLARE @SQL VARCHAR(MAX);  
SET @SQL=''  
SELECT @SQL=@SQL+'; KILL '+RTRIM(SPID)  
FROM master..sysprocesses  
WHERE dbid=DB_ID('数据库名');  

EXEC(@SQL);

 

ALTER DATABASE 数据库名 SET MULTI_USER;

相关文章:

  • 2022-12-23
  • 2022-01-16
  • 2021-06-25
  • 2021-08-30
  • 2021-12-09
  • 2021-12-26
猜你喜欢
  • 2022-03-01
  • 2021-12-15
  • 2022-12-23
  • 2022-01-25
  • 2022-12-23
  • 2021-06-13
相关资源
相似解决方案